Sr Java Web Developer Resume
Pittsburgh, PA
SUMMARY
- 8+ years of experience in all phases of Software Development Life Cycle using Java / J2EE technologies.
- Experience in Web based application development using Java/J2EE, JSP, Servlets, JDBC, Struts, Hibernate, Spring,JSF, Web Services and XML.
- Experience working on different domains like business, health and finance.
- Expertise in developing both SOAP and REST based webservices.
- Proven software development experience using different methodologies - Agile and Waterfall
- Thorough knowledge in SQL and experience in RDBMS like Oracle and MySQL
- Experienced in all phases of SDLC including analysis, design, coding and testing.
- Solid experience in deploying J2EE components on ApacheTomcat, BEA WebLogic and IBM WebSphere, JBOSSapplication servers.
- Thorough knowledge of Web technologies: XML, AJAX, HTML, CSS and JavaScript.
- Proficient in Java/J2EE Design Patterns including singleton, command, ModelViewController (MVC), DataAccessObject (DAO), and BusinessDelegate.
- Hands-on experience in IDE Tools: Eclipse, NetBeans, My Eclipse. Hands on working experience with Production Support Teams.
- Experience in requirement analysis & gathering, andinUML - for developing application specific Object model, Use Case diagrams, Class diagrams, Sequence diagrams & State diagrams.
- Strong experience in implementing MVC framework like Struts 2.0, Spring 2.x and ORM tools like Hibernate in J2EE architecture
- Experienced in buildtools like Ant and Maven, Log4j for Logging and jUnit for testing.
- Developed Complex database objects like Stored Procedures, Functions, Packages and Triggers using SQL and PL/SQL.
- Expertise in using J2EEApplication Serverssuch as IBM WebSphere 4.x/5.x/6.x, WebLogic, JBoss3.x and Web Servers like Tomcat 5.x/6.x
- Extensively used IDE for Application development like RAD 6.0, Eclipse3.x, Net Beans. Experienced in database GUI/IDE Tools using TOAD and MySQL Client
- Experienced in handling Version Control Systems like TFS,CVS, VSS and SVN,AWS, ClearCase.
- Working experience with the operating systems like UNIX, Solaris and Windows
- Development experience includes working with cross functional team and global development teams in Onshore/Offshore Model
- Expertise in object modelling and objectorienteddesign methodologies (UML). Experience with UML diagrams like Class, Object, Use Case, State, Activity diagrams
- Strong analytical, interpersonal and communications skills. Demonstrated track record of analyzing situations, implementing in a fastpaced environment.
TECHNICAL SKILLS
Language: Java/J2ee, SQL, PL/SQL, HTML, JavaScript,UML, XML, jQuery
J2EEStandards: JDBC, JNDI, Java Mail, JTA
Web Technologies: JSP, Servlet, JAX-WS, SOA, SOAP, JMS, IBM MQSeries, EJB
RDBMS: Oracle, MySQL, Mongo DB.
IDE’s: RAD, Eclipse, NetBeans,Eclipse RPC
Web/App Servers: WebSphereApplication Server, WebLogic, JBOSS, Tomcat
Frameworks: Struts, JSF, SpringMVC, Hibernate, jQuery, AngularJS,NodeJs
Operating Systems: Windows 2000/XP, UNIX, Solaris, Red Hat Linux
Case Tools: Rational Rose, MS Visio
Development Tools: TOAD, CVS, ClearCase, JUnit, Log4J, WebMethods
PROFESSIONAL EXPERIENCE
Confidential, Pittsburgh, PA
Sr Java Web Developer
Responsibilities:
- Worked on Rally dev for define user stories, tasks and defects and carried out the project with Agile Scrum.
- Worked on various enhancements on the front-end design using JSF and Ice Faces frameworks.
- Developed a web page where a person who is remotely working for the company can register with HTML5 and CSS3 on front end design and ORACLE/PLSQL on the backend.
- Also made the JAX-WS web service call, where the values populated from above form will be consumed by the database and tested it in SOAP UI.
- Handled several tickets for this application which improved overall grip with handling issues on both UI and backend side.
- Also worked on installation, deployment and configuration moved it through three different environments.
- Worked on enhancements with Office 365 Outlook Email configuration and developed a procedure which would give access for employees to this new outlook email.
- Wrote Junit classes for the services and prepared documentation and configured logging in the application using log 4j API.
- Developed Hibernate entities and performed Object relation mappings and wrote criteria queries for the data retrievals.
- Securely configured based on the requirements and also helped in making fixes to various performance related issues.
- Worked on the Java middle tier development using Spring DI, REST API and JSON.
- Developed web applications using Spring MVC, jQuery and HTML5.
- Developed front-end code with Ajax call in AngularJS and jQuery to retrieve data as JSON Object from controllers in back-end RESTful Server, then display the well-organized result in web pages by writing AngularJS controller, directives, services, and route providers. Also used Angular.js filter to make the data searchable and sortable.
Environment: JAVA/J2EE, RAD, IBM-WEBSPHERE 8.0, HTML5 & HTML, CSS3 & CSS, JSF, ORACLE/PLSQL, SERVLET, JSP, CLEAR-CASE, CLEAR-QUEST, SOAP-UI, JAX-WS, AngularJS
Confidential, Columbus, OH
Sr Java Web Developer
Responsibilities:
- Worked on Rally dev for define user stories, tasks and defects and carried out the project with Agile Scrum.
- Used Sonar and Jenkins tools for code review and integration testing.
- Have used Angular Ajax using httpservice to send the form data and receive data in the form of JSON and XML.
- Created the NodeJS app using yeoman, Grunt and Bower and used Angular UI for component model.
- Developed Angular MVC components and performed dependency injection and employed two-way data binding.
- Used AngularJS-UI components for web application development and worked extensively on directives, filters, services and controllers.
- Represented user data to business users using HTML5, CSS3 and JavaScript.
- Built dynamically generated dropdown lists using Ajax, jQuery andBackboneJS.
- Worked withAngularJSMVC framework including authoring complex directives, services, controllers and filters; working with animations, routing and states.
- Oracle mainframe interface development involved COBOL Programs, JCL, PROC, Database mapping Involved Microsoft Office products, ORACLE DB and ORACLE GI (Generic Interface) tool.
- Worked on the Java middle tier development using Spring DI, REST API and JSON.
- Developed web applications using Spring MVC, jQuery and HTML5.
- Created differentAngulardirectives which are used across the different templates in the Single Page application.
- Validating the Application by Deploying and testing onWebSphere 8.x Server.
- Responsible for maintaining the code quality, coding and implementation standards by code reviews.
Environment: Java 1.7, Junit 4, WebSphere8.5, MS SQL Server, JSP, Angular JS, Spring DI, Spring MVC, RAD8, Restful Web services, Jasmine, log4j, Node JS, JavaScript, Mongo DB, SQL, PL/SQL, Oracle11i.
